566,346 (five hundred sixty-six thousand three hundred forty-six) is an even 6-digit number. It is a composite number with 16 divisors, and factors as 2 × 3 × 11 × 8,581. Its proper divisors sum to 669,462, more than the number itself, making it an abundant number. Written other ways, in hexadecimal, 0x8A44A.
